Moroccan Quinoa Medley Recipe

Moroccan Quinoa Medley Recipe is Middle Eastern inspired and uses quinoa, chicken stock, tomatoes, chickpeas, carrot, mint, lemon juice, cheese, cumin and pine nuts and is delicious with grilled chicken or salmon burgers.
Food Category:    Vegetables
Cuisine Origin:    Middle Eastern
  
    • Servings:4
    • Nutrition facts:511 calories22.4 grams fat

INGREDIENTS

  • 1 cup uncooked quinoa, rinsed
  • 2 cups low-sodium chicken stock
  • 12 cherry tomatoes, halved
  • 1 cup cooked chickpeas (can use low-sodium, canned chickpeas; rinse first)
  • 1/2 cup shredded carrot
  • 2 tbsp chopped fresh mint
  • 2 tbsp fresh lemon juice
  • 2 oz goat cheese crumbled
  • 1/2 tsp sea salt
  • freshly ground pepper
  • 1 tsp cumin
  • 2 tbsp extra virgin olive oil
  • 2 tsp pine nuts

DIRECTIONS

  • In a heavy-bottom saucepan combine quinoa and stock and bring to boil over medium-high heat. Reduce heat and simer on medium-low about 12 minutes until quinoa is soft, and liquid is absorbed.
  • In a large bowl combine cooked quinoa, tomatoes, chickpeas, carrot, mint, lemon juice, goat cheese, salt, pepper, cumin, and olive oil. Mix thoroughly.
  • Sprinkle pine nuts on top, and serve dish warm or at room temperature.
